/*
* OTA web updater with modest Flash filesystem management
** format FS (SPIFFS or LittelFS)
** list dir
** upload file
** create file
** edit file
** delete file
* MUST be compiled with one of the partition shemes with OTA + FileSystem
* Adapted from the OTAWebUpdater example and
* https://github.com/roberttidey/BaseSupport
*
* Richard Palmer 2023
* Modified by Dan Peirce B.Sc. June 2023
*/
//#define LITTLE_FS 0 // these three lines moved to filecode.h
//#define SPIFFS_FS 1
//#define FILESYSTYPE LITTLE_FS // Set to on or the other before compile
const char* host = "esp32ota";
#define FILEBUFSIZ 4096
#ifndef WM_PORTALTIMEOUT
#define WM_PORTALTIMEOUT 180
#endif
#include <WiFi.h>
#include <WiFiClient.h>
#include <WebServer.h>
#include <time.h>
#include <ESPmDNS.h>
#include <Update.h>
#include <WiFiServer.h>
#include <WiFiManager.h> // https://github.com/tzapu/WiFiManager
#include "filecode.h"
#include "webpages.h"
//#include <HTTPUpdateServer.h>
WebServer server(80);
bool fsFound = false;
long timezone = -8; // This timezone was set for Vancouver BC Canada (Same as L.A. USA)
byte daysavetime = 1; // Set in June for DST
void setup(void)
{
Serial.begin(115200);
delay(3000);
//WiFiManager, Local intialization. Once its business is done, there is no need to keep it around
WiFiManager wm;
// reset settings - wipe stored credentials for testing
// these are stored by the esp library
// wm.resetSettings();
// Automatically connect using saved credentials,
// if connection fails, it starts an access point with the specified name ( "AutoConnectAP"),
// if empty will auto generate SSID, if password is blank it will be anonymous AP (wm.autoConnect())
// then goes into a blocking loop awaiting configuration and will return success result
bool res;
// res = wm.autoConnect(); // auto generated AP name from chipid
res = wm.autoConnect("ESP32-FS-AP"); // anonymous ap
//res = wm.autoConnect("ESP-AP","password"); // password protected ap
if(!res) {
Serial.println("Failed to connect");
// ESP.restart();
}
else {
//if you get here you have connected to the WiFi
Serial.println("");
}
fsFound = initFS(false, false); // is an FS already in place?
Serial.println("Contacting Time Server");
configTime(3600*timezone, daysavetime*3600, "time.nist.gov", "0.pool.ntp.org", "1.pool.ntp.org");
struct tm tmstruct ;
delay(2000);
tmstruct.tm_year = 0;
getLocalTime(&tmstruct, 5000);
Serial.printf("\nNow is : %d-%02d-%02d %02d:%02d:%02d\n",(tmstruct.tm_year)+1900,( tmstruct.tm_mon)+1, tmstruct.tm_mday,tmstruct.tm_hour , tmstruct.tm_min, tmstruct.tm_sec);
Serial.println("");
static char starttime[32];
sprintf(starttime, "%d-%02d-%02d %02d:%02d:%02d\n",(tmstruct.tm_year)+1900,( tmstruct.tm_mon)+1, tmstruct.tm_mday,tmstruct.tm_hour , tmstruct.tm_min, tmstruct.tm_sec);
/*use mdns for host name resolution*/
if (!MDNS.begin(host)) // http://ESP32OTA.local
Serial.println("Error setting up MDNS responder!");
else
Serial.printf("mDNS responder started. Hotstname = http://%s.local\n", host);
server.on("/", HTTP_GET, handleMain);
// upload file to FS. Three callbacks
server.on("/update", HTTP_POST, []() {
server.sendHeader("Connection", "close");
server.send(200, "text/plain", (Update.hasError()) ? "FAIL" : "OK");
ESP.restart();
}, []() {
HTTPUpload& upload = server.upload();
if (upload.status == UPLOAD_FILE_START) {
Serial.printf("Update: %s\n", upload.filename.c_str());
if (!Update.begin(UPDATE_SIZE_UNKNOWN)) { //start with max available size
Update.printError(Serial);
}
} else if (upload.status == UPLOAD_FILE_WRITE) {
/* flashing firmware to ESP*/
if (Update.write(upload.buf, upload.currentSize) != upload.currentSize) {
Update.printError(Serial);
}
} else if (upload.status == UPLOAD_FILE_END) {
if (Update.end(true)) { //true to set the size to the current progress
Serial.printf("Update Success: %u\nRebooting...\n", upload.totalSize);
} else {
Update.printError(Serial);
}
}
});
server.on("/delete", HTTP_GET, handleFileDelete);
server.on("/main", HTTP_GET, handleMain); // JSON format used by /edit
// second callback handles file uploads at that location
server.on("/edit", HTTP_POST, []()
{server.send(200, "text/html", "<meta http-equiv='refresh' content='1;url=/main'>File uploaded. <a href=/main>Back to list</a>"); }, handleFileUpload);
server.onNotFound([](){if(!handleFileRead(server.uri())) server.send(404, "text/plain", "404 FileNotFound");});
server.begin();
}
void loop(void)
{
server.handleClient();
delay(1);
}
